If you speak two languages, you are bilingual.
If you speak three languages, you are trilingual.
If you speak one language, you are American.

I believe in bilingual education in this country from age 7. I think the parents should have a choice though. It is hard to say what language makes the best choice in the growing global economy. Learning Japanese and Chinese may be just as valuable as learning Spanish, French, or German.

And the teaching in the classroom can't be just textbook. It has to be total immersion. Newspapers, events (school lunches), etc. all in the other language.

It's sad that my father is French Canadian and I have learned hardly a word. I would love to be completely bilingual. It would be much easier to start at age 7 than now. We had a teacher in middle school who spoke 7 languages.
